Monday, June 8, 2009

Song of the Week-Sick Puppies "Street Fighter (War)"

This week's song is by Sick Puppies, and if you're a fan of Street Fighter, you might have heard this song in the latest Street Fighter video game commercial. It's called War, and it's part of their new album Tri-Polar, which is set to be released July 14th. Good stuff.

You can also check them out at

No comments: